About Rock Rabbit

At Rock Rabbit, our mission is to make future-proofing homes easy and affordable for everyone. As a VC-backed, seed-stage climate tech startup, we are building AI-powered mobile and web platform to streamline process, proof, and payment of electrification rebates and financing, making it easier for our customers to navigate the complex world of incentive programs.

We are a small, mission-driven team that is energized by the impact of our work in decarbonizing our built environment. As a remote-first team, we believe in the importance of curiosity, collaboration and cultivating compassion for our teammates and customers.

The Role

Rock Rabbit is seeking a Lead Full-stack Engineer to join our growing founding team developing a building decarbonization management platform. Our software focuses heavily on data modeling and external integrations, and we're looking for a highly skilled professional to join us in creating a system built with a service-oriented architecture in mind. The ideal candidate will have deep expertise in leading agile development teams and delivery of SaaS applications.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the engineering team in the development of efficient, high-quality, maintainable, scalable and reliable code to ensure the best possible performance, quality, and responsiveness of our systems
  • Manage key responsibilities within the agile software development project lifecycle, including day-to-day project management, scoping and planning, and risk management
  • Work closely with SMEs, and the product and design teams to understand end-user requirements and use cases, then translate that into a pragmatic and effective technical solution.
  • Lead technical design and development of the SaaS platform for building decarbonization.
  • Build and maintain APIs, services, and systems across our platform.
  • Build efficient, reusable and reliable code ensuring the best possible performance, quality, and responsiveness of our systems.
  • Conduct code reviews and help maintain high standards of code quality.

About You

  • Proven experience as a technical lead, preferably with a SaaS company.
  • Experience with building SaaS platforms and software solutions addressing business needs
  • Familiarity with service-oriented architectures.
  • Strong proficiency in Python. Experience with ASGI is highly desirable.
  • Experience with frontend development, including a common framework such as React.
  • Understanding of fundamental design principles behind a scalable application.
  • Proficiency in data modeling and building external integrations.
  • Excellent problem-solving abilities and communication skills.
  • Familiarity with agile software development methodologies and tools.
  • Adaptability and flexibility to work in an early-stage startup environment.

Compensation

The U.S. base salary range for this position is $130,000 - $160,000 plus benefits, equity and variable compensation for Sales-related roles. This range represents Rock Rabbit’s good faith estimate of competitively-priced salary for the role based on national, real-time industry data from companies of a similar growth stage. This range reflects minimum and maximum new hire salaries for the role across US locations. Within the range, individual pay is determined by location and individual factors including relevant skills, experience and education or training. This range correlates to the relative level of the candidate we believe we need for the role and may require an adjustment for candidates of a different level. We can share more about the specific salary range for the location this role is based during the hiring process.
